(1) See Note 8, “Unfunded Loan Commitments,” for a summary of the activity in the allowance for and balance of unfunded loan commitments, respectively.
(2) Below is a reconciliation of the provisions for credit losses reported in the consolidated statements of income. When a new loan commitment is made, we record the CECL allowance as a liability for unfunded loan commitments by recording a provision for credit losses. When the loan is funded, we transfer that liability to the allowance for credit losses.

(3) For the year ended December 31, 2022, there were no allowance for credit losses, loans, or accrued interest to be capitalized balances that were individually evaluated for impairment.
(4) Loans in repayment include loans on which borrowers are making interest only or fixed payments, as well as loans that have entered full principal and interest repayment status after any applicable grace period.
(5) Accrued interest to be capitalized on loans in repayment includes interest on loans that are in repayment but have not yet entered into full principal and interest repayment status after any applicable grace period (but, for purposes of the table, does not include the interest on those loans while they are in forbearance).

The tables below summarize the activity in the allowance recorded to cover lifetime expected credit losses on the unfunded commitments, which is recorded in “Other Liabilities” on the consolidated balance sheets, as well as the activity in the unfunded commitments balance.
Years ended December 31, (dollars in thousands)202220212020
AllowanceUnfunded CommitmentsAllowanceUnfunded CommitmentsAllowanceUnfunded Commitments
Beginning Balance$72,713 $1,776,976 $110,044 $1,673,018 $2,481 $1,910,603 
Day 1 adjustment for the adoption of CECL— — — — 115,758 — 
Balance at January 172,713 1,776,976 110,044 1,673,018 118,239 1,910,603 
Provision/New commitments - net(1)
365,359 6,180,805 232,822 5,512,841 311,659 5,070,175 
Other provision items31,162 — 31,502 — 954 — 
Transfer - funded loans(2)
(344,310)(5,961,973)(301,655)(5,408,883)(320,808)(5,307,760)
Ending Balance$124,924 $1,995,808 $72,713 $1,776,976 $110,044 $1,673,018 
(1)  Net of expirations of commitments unused.
(2)  When a loan commitment is funded, its related liability for credit losses (which originally was recorded as a provision for unfunded commitments) is transferred to the allowance for credit losses.
